Code AE / E1
AE or E1 means water has reached the dishwasher base area and activated the leak/float sensing system.
Code bE
LG identifies bE as a bubble error, often caused by using hand dishwashing liquid or another detergent that creates excessive suds.
Code FE
FE indicates an abnormal fill or overfill condition.
Code IE
IE indicates that the dishwasher is not filling with water as expected.
Code LE / CE
LE or CE indicates a dishwasher motor-related fault on applicable LG models.
Code OE
OE indicates that the dishwasher detected a draining problem.
Code d80
d80, d90, or d95 indicates 80%, 90%, or 95% airflow restriction in the home exhaust vent system.
Code d90
d90 means the dryer has detected an exhaust restriction of about 90 percent through its Flow Sense monitoring.
Code d95
d95 means the dryer has detected an extremely severe exhaust restriction of about 95 percent through Flow Sense monitoring.
Code F-11
F-11 code indicates power generation failure from inverter board to magnetron tube.
Code F-3
F-3 code displays when the control panel detects continuous touch contact on any button key for over 60 seconds.
Code F3
F3 error signals that the main control detects an open circuit in the oven thermistor circuit.
Code F9
F9 code indicates the oven failed to heat up above 150°F after 5 minutes of active preheating call.
Code 22
LG code 22 is associated on affected refrigerators with a compressor-start or relay-related fault.
Code 33
LG lists code 33 among refrigerator diagnostic codes; on affected models it indicates a water/ice-system fault requiring model-specific diagnosis.
Code 67
LG code 67 indicates a door gap or door-related condition on affected refrigerators.
Code 88
LG lists 88 as a refrigerator diagnostic code that requires model-specific interpretation.
Code Er FF
Er FF code signals a failure in the freezer evaporator fan motor circuit or ice buildup blocking fan operation.
